Installation for filling containers

    Abstract: A filling installation comprising a fixed frame, a tank mounted on the fixed frame so as to rotate about an axis, and a lid associated with the tank and provided with a feed pipe, positioning means being fixed to the lid, and being mounted on the fixed frame to slide parallel to the axis of rotation between a position in which the lid is applied against an edge of the tank so as to close off said tank and a position in which the lid is spaced apart from the edge of the tank.

    Abstract: A method of sterilizing containers by means of an electron gun, the method comprising the steps of inserting the gun into an opening of the container and of applying electron bombardment, and also the step of orienting the container so that it has its opening directed downwards prior to inserting the gun therein. The invention also provides an installation for implementing the method.

    Abstract: The invention relates to a device for forming and welding blanks in a material able to become superplastic, of the type comprising cooperating dies between which such blanks are placed, which dies are respectively mounted on a lower frame and on an upper frame of the device.The device according to the invention is remarkable in that the lower frame is constituted of a base and of a vertically movable part carrying a die, in that an inflatable bladder is interposed between the base and the movable part of the lower frame, in that a mechanical a lock is provided for connecting together the the base and the upper frame, when the latter is in low position, and in that, in the low and locked position of the upper frame with respect to the base of the lower frame, cooperation of the dies is achieved by controlling the bladder.

    Abstract: The container capping device includes a capping head carried by a hollow support member in the shape of a bracket, vertically movable and including a vertical part going through a cover, with the rotation driving mechanism of the capping head and the control mechanism of the jaws of the capping head being enclosed in the part of the support member which extends above the cover.

    Abstract: This invention relates to a tool support, particularly for a robot, of the type comprising two parts connected together by an assembly of elastic plates which, at rest, are disposed tangentially to a circle concentric to a reference axis of said robot with which the axis of the tool merges, and which, when working, enable that part of said support which bears the tool to move with respect to said reference axis, wherein each of said plates is connected to one of said parts of the tool support via a swivel joint assembly or the like and to the other of said parts via an articulation whose axis is at right angles to said reference axis. The invention is more particularly applicable to automatic machining with displacement of the tool parallel to itself.
